one other thing that isnt shown it is also bolted with 5 bolts. 3- 3/8 bolts and 2 1/2 inch bolts. all are sleeved between the pan and the inner boxside. the 1/2 inch bolts are also what the highlift is mounted to. the axe and shovel are held to the highlift with bungies.

as far as covering it with the original sheetmetal, it would be about impossiable because everything isnt inset. if you look in the last picture you can see that the jack and shovel are out past the body line. but am plannin on a canvas cover in the future.
